Form Priorities: The Foundation of Safe Training

Why Form Matters More Than Weight

Published injury data indicates that the majority of resistance training injuries result from improper technique rather than equipment failure. When form degrades, stress shifts from target muscles to joints, ligaments, and the spine — structures not designed to bear loads in those positions.

Universal Form Checklist

Apply these checkpoints to every weighted exercise:

CheckpointWhat to Verify
Neutral spineMaintain the natural curves of your spine; avoid rounding or excessive arching
Controlled tempo2–3 seconds lowering (eccentric), 1–2 seconds lifting (concentric), no bouncing
Full range of motionMove through the complete pain-free range for each exercise
Stable baseFeet flat and planted; weight distributed evenly
Joint alignmentKnees track over toes; elbows stay below shoulder height for pressing
BreathingExhale during exertion; never hold your breath during heavy efforts (Valsalva)

The Valsalva Maneuver: When to Use Caution

The Valsalva maneuver — holding your breath during heavy lifts to increase intra-abdominal pressure — is a standard technique among strength athletes. However, our research indicates it carries risks for certain populations:

PopulationValsalva Risk LevelRecommendation
Healthy adults, moderate loadsLowBrief breath hold (1–2 seconds) acceptable at near-maximal loads
Healthy adults, general trainingLowExhale through the sticking point instead
Hypertension (elevated blood pressure)ModerateAvoid Valsalva; use continuous breathing
Cardiovascular diseaseHighAvoid Valsalva entirely; consult physician
PregnancyHighAvoid Valsalva; use continuous breathing
BeginnersLow-moderateLearn proper breathing before attempting maximal loads

Warm-Up Protocol

A proper warm-up prepares your nervous system, increases tissue temperature, and activates the muscles you will train. Skipping warm-up is associated with higher injury rates in published studies.

The RAMP Warm-Up Structure

PhaseDurationActivityPurpose
Raise3–5 minutesLight cardio (marching, jump rope, stationary bike)Increase core temperature and blood flow
Activate3–5 minutesDynamic movements for target muscles (leg swings, arm circles, hip circles)Activate muscles and mobilize joints
Mobilize2–3 minutesDynamic stretches through full range of motionIncrease range of motion for upcoming exercises
Potentiate2–3 minutesMovement-specific warm-up with light loadsPrepare the exact movement pattern

Total warm-up time: 10–16 minutes.

Sample warm-up for a lower-body session:

  1. Raise: 3 minutes stationary bike or marching in place
  2. Activate: Bodyweight squats (10 reps), alternating lunges (10 reps), glute bridges (10 reps)
  3. Mobilize: Walking leg swings (10 per leg), deep bodyweight squat hold (20 seconds), hip circles (10 per direction)
  4. Potentiate: Goblet squat with light dumbbell (10 reps), Romanian deadlift with light weight (10 reps)

Common error: Static stretching before strength training. Published research indicates that prolonged static stretching (60+ seconds per muscle) immediately before power or strength work may temporarily reduce force output. Save static stretching for after your workout.


Spotter Alternatives for Solo Training

Training alone means no spotter. Our analysis provides safer alternatives for exercises that typically require assistance.

Exercise-Specific Safety Substitutions

ExerciseSpotter FunctionSolo Alternative
Barbell bench pressPrevent bar from dropping on chestDumbbell bench press (drop safely); floor press (limited range); power rack with safety pins set at chest level
Barbell squatAssist if athlete failsSquat rack with safety pins set at appropriate height; goblet squats; Smith machine (acknowledging limitations)
Barbell overhead pressAssist if bar falls backwardSeated version with back support; dumbbell overhead press; power rack with pins
Barbell back squat (maximal)Assist out of bottom positionUse squat stands with spotter arms; leave 1–2 reps in reserve; do not train to true failure on barbell squats
Barbell bicep curl (heavy cheat curls)Prevent bar from fallingUse EZ curl bar or dumbbells; lighter weight with strict form

The Safety Pin Rule

When using a power rack or squat stand with safety pins:

  1. Set the safety pins 1–2 inches below the lowest point of your range of motion.
  2. Perform a practice rep with the empty bar to verify pin height.
  3. If you fail a rep, lower the bar to the pins with control. Do not dump the bar suddenly.
  4. Always verify that both pins are at the same height before loading.

Training to Failure: Solo Guidelines

Exercise TypeFailure Training RiskRecommendation
Machine-basedLowGenerally safe to train to failure alone
DumbbellLow-moderateTrain to failure only on exercises where dumbbells can be dropped safely (bench, curls, rows)
Barbell (with safety pins)ModerateTrain to failure only with safety pins properly set
Barbell (no safety pins)HighDo not train to failure; leave 1–3 reps in reserve

Equipment Inspection Checklist

Inspect your equipment regularly. The following schedule is based on manufacturer recommendations and observed failure patterns.

Daily Pre-Workout Inspection (1 Minute)

ItemWhat to CheckIf Defective
Cables (machines, resistance systems)Fraying, kinking, unusual wearDo not use; replace immediately
Collars (barbell/dumbbell)Secure closure, no cracksReplace before use
Bench / seat paddingTears, loose bolts, wobblingTighten bolts; pad tears are cosmetic unless structural
FlooringNew tears, exposed subfloorCover or replace before next session
Adjustable dumbbell mechanismsProper locking, no loose componentsDo not use if selector does not engage fully

Weekly Inspection (5 Minutes)

ItemWhat to CheckAction
All bolts and fastenersTightnessTighten to manufacturer specifications
Barbell sleevesSpin smoothly; no excessive playLubricate if needed; replace if damaged
Resistance bandsCracks, nicks, thinning areasDiscard damaged bands immediately
Cable attachmentsCarabiners, handles, straps for wearReplace worn components
Power rack / cageUpright stability; bolt tightnessTighten all bolts; check for frame deformation

Monthly Inspection (15 Minutes)

ItemWhat to CheckAction
Weight platesCracks, chips, collar hole wearReplace cracked plates; chipped plates are usable if structurally sound
Barbell shaftStraightness (roll on flat surface); knurling wearReplace bent bars; knurl wear is cosmetic
Pulley systemsSmooth operation; alignmentLubricate; adjust if misaligned
Hydraulic systemsLeaks, resistance consistencyService or replace if resistance is inconsistent
Flooring conditionCompression, tears, separationReplace compressed or torn sections

Pain vs. Discomfort: When to Stop

Understanding the difference between productive discomfort and injury-warning pain is essential for safe training. n

Discomfort (Normal, Generally Safe)

SensationDescriptionAction
Muscle burnLocalized, warm, builds gradually during setNormal; continue if form is maintained
Muscle fatigueDecreasing strength, shakiness, reduced rep qualityNormal near end of set; stop if form degrades
Mild muscle soreness (DOMS)Dull ache 24–72 hours post-workout, bilateralNormal; train through light soreness; rest severe soreness
Stretch sensationElongation feeling during range of motionNormal within normal range; do not force beyond

Pain (Warning Sign, Stop Immediately)

SensationDescriptionAction
Sharp or stabbingSudden, intense, localizedStop immediately; assess; seek medical attention if it persists
Joint painPain inside or around a joint (knee, shoulder, elbow, hip)Stop the exercise; modify or substitute; consult professional if recurrent
Radiating painPain that travels along a limb (e.g., down the leg from lower back)Stop; this may indicate nerve involvement; consult healthcare provider
Unilateral painPain on one side only, especially if sudden onsetStop; compare to the other side; if it does not resolve in 48 hours, consult professional
Pain with swellingPain accompanied by visible swelling, bruising, or deformityStop immediately; apply RICE (rest, ice, compression, elevation); seek medical evaluation
Pain that worsensDiscomfort that increases set-to-set or workout-to-workoutStop the aggravating exercise; modify; consult professional if not improving in 1–2 weeks

The 48-Hour Rule

If pain does not improve within 48 hours of rest, ice, and modified activity, consult a healthcare provider. Persistent pain is your body’s signal that something requires professional assessment. Training through pain rarely resolves the underlying issue and often worsens it.


Emergency Procedures

If an Injury Occurs During Training

  1. Stop the exercise immediately. Do not try to finish the set or workout.
  2. Assess severity. Can you bear weight or move the limb through a comfortable range?
  3. For minor strains or sprains: Apply RICE protocol (Rest, Ice, Compression, Elevation) for the first 24–48 hours. Avoid heat, alcohol, running, and massage during this period (the PRICE protocol adds Protection).
  4. For severe injuries: Call emergency services if there is deformity, inability to bear weight, severe swelling, loss of consciousness, or chest pain.
  5. Document what happened. Note the exercise, weight, what you felt, and the circumstances. This information is valuable for healthcare providers.

Emergency Contact Preparation

PreparationWhy It Matters
Phone accessibleYou cannot call for help if your phone is in another room and you cannot walk
Someone knows you work out aloneIf you do not check in, they know to investigate
Emergency contacts savedFirst responders need emergency contact information
Know your addressIn a panic, people sometimes cannot recall their exact address for 911
First aid kit nearbyImmediate treatment for minor injuries; stabilization for major ones until help arrives

First Aid Kit for Home Gym

ItemPurpose
Adhesive bandagesMinor cuts and scrapes
Elastic bandage (ACE wrap)Compression for sprains; joint support
Instant cold packsReduce swelling for acute injuries
Athletic tapeSupport for minor strains; immobilization
Antiseptic wipesClean wounds
TweezersRemove splinters or debris
Emergency contact cardYour address, emergency contacts, allergies
